What types of water treatment processes can be automated?
We can automate virtually all water treatment processes including raw water intake, coagulation/flocculation, sedimentation, filtration, disinfection (chlorination, UV, ozone), pH adjustment, fluoridation, and finished water distribution. Our systems also handle wastewater treatment stages such as preliminary screening, primary clarification, biological treatment, and sludge processing.

How do you ensure cybersecurity for water treatment control systems?
We implement multi-layered security including network segmentation, firewalls, intrusion detection systems, encrypted communications, role-based access controls, and regular security audits. Our designs comply with EPA guidelines and industry standards such as AWWA's Cybersecurity Guidance, protecting your critical infrastructure while maintaining necessary operational visibility.

How does automation help with regulatory compliance?
Our systems automatically log all critical parameters required for EPA and state regulatory reporting, generate compliance reports, provide alarm notification for out-of-range conditions, and maintain complete audit trails. This reduces manual data collection errors, ensures timely reporting, and provides documentation to demonstrate compliance during inspections.
